Re: P1071 Code: System mixture to lean (Bank 1)

I would would pursue the P0102 DTC which is the MAF sensor. It has a low output frequency of less than 1500 Hz. Also, FSM lists it as a possible cause of the P0171 DTC. A scan with a full function scanner which Autozone does not use would probably show the short and long term trim values out of spec and point to the MAF.

I mentioned earlier to disconnect the MAF and then check driveability. See if the hesitation and bog disappears. You can safely drive with the MAF disconnected. The PCM will switch over the default programming when it sees no MAF signal.


Quote:
Originally Posted by BNaylor
Switch back to the recommended 91 octane or better and then see what it does. Combustion chamber and exhaust temperatures are higher with lower grade octane. It may have affected the pre-CAT 02 sensor. The Bank 1 02 sensor is used to control the fuel injection system in closed loop mode of operation. DTC P0171 indicates you are getting a short term or long term fuel trim either due to a lean or rich condition.

Also, disconnect the MAF sensor and see what it does?

Thumbs up Re: P1071 Code: System mixture to lean (Bank 1)

Well I pursued the P0102 DTC. As suggested I unplugged the maf (with car off this time). Car idled much better with no hesitation or stalling at all. Purchased some CRC maf cleaner, removed maf, cleaned and re-installed.
But symptoms remained the same. Ordered a new maf sensor from AZ
(cardone). Installed as per directions supplied, and the car is performing beautifully. Prior to installing the new maf. I sprayed the throttle with CRC throttle body cleaner. BTW SES indication dissapeared on its own. So in closing this thread. I would like to thank the following for there help and input.
